Geopier announces Jack Salerno, MECE, PE as Vice President of Operations for North America.
Geopier recently announced that it has appointed Jack Salerno, MECE, PE as Vice President of Operations for North America. Salerno brings over 30 years of experience to the role, and served as Vice President for several New York Companies, including Geocomp Corporation, TRC/Site‐Blauvelt Engineers and Urbitran Associates Inc.
In his new role, Mr. Salerno will be a core member of the leadership team and be responsible for the company's day‐to‐day operating activities that support the achievement of the business strategy and financial goals. Mr. Salerno will manage Commercial, Marketing, Finance, Information Technology, Human Resources, Legal and Office Administration activities.
“Jack will be an asset to the growth of the company,” said Kord Wissmann, President and Chief Engineer of Geopier Foundations. “His extensive background will help Geopier strengthen our value proposition and expand our commercial growth. We believe his strong leadership experience will help deliver dayto‐ day results, while focusing on the customer’s needs.”
“I am very excited to be joining the Geopier family in this newly created position,” said Jack Salerno. “I believe Geopier has a great business model and a talented team that uniquely positions us to evolve with the industry and I look forward to be part of their future success.”
Salerno graduated with his MECE from Stevens Institute of Technology in Hoboken, NJ and his Bachelor’s in Civil Engineering from Youngstown State University in Youngstown, Ohio.
